Output d8b59b27b92f07a66866cf47c47949c114ae730625f7e7eed338bae558dbd2ab:0

value
33000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3da24baad0681e4031752b510c24b74fa0e30394 OP_EQUALVERIFY OP_CHECKSIG
address
16cteCN35EhizGSUK4Smd7E1TvrBs572sX
transaction
d8b59b27b92f07a66866cf47c47949c114ae730625f7e7eed338bae558dbd2ab
spent
true